Maison  >  Questions et réponses  >  le corps du texte

javascript - Pourquoi ai-je toujours une erreur lors de l'installation de Node-Sass à l'aide de NPM ?

错误代码:
gyp ERR ! configurez l'erreur
gyp ERR ! Erreur de pile : impossible de trouver l'exécutable Python "python", vous pouvez définir la variable d'environnement PYT
HON.
gyp ERR ! pile sur PythonFinder.failNoPython (C:Users***AppDataRoami
ngnpmnode_modulesnode-sassnode_modulesnode-gyplibconfigure.js:483:19)
gyp ERR ! pile sur PythonFinder.<anonyme> (C:Users***AppDataRoamin
gnpmnode_modulesnode-sassnode_modulesnode-gyplibconfigure.js:508:16)
gyp ERR ! pile sur C:Users***AppDataRoamingnpmnode_modulesnode-sa
ssnode_modulesgraceful-fspolyfills.js:284:29
gyp ERR ! pile sur FSReqWrap.oncomplete (fs.js:152:21)
gyp ERR ! Système Windows_NT 6.1.7601
gyp ERR ! commande "D:Program Filesnodejsnode.exe" "C:Users*App
DataRoamingnpmnode_modulesnode-sassnode_modulesnode-gypbinnode-g
yp.js" "rebuild" "--verbose" "--libsass_ext=" "--libsass_cflags=" "--libsass_ldf
lags=" "--libsass_library="
gyp ERR ! cwd C:Utilisateurs***AppDataRoamingnpmnode_modulesnode-sass
gyp ERR ! node -v v8.0.0
gyp ERR ! node-gyp -v v3.6.2
gyp ERR ! pas ok
La construction a échoué avec le code d'erreur : 1
npm ERR ! code ELIFECYCLE
npm ERR ! numéro d'erreur 1
npm ERR ! node-sass@4.5.3 post-installation : node scripts/build.js
npm ERR ! Statut de sortie 1
npm ERR !
npm ERR ! Échec du script de post-installation node-sass@4.5.3.
npm ERR ! Ce n'est probablement pas un problème avec npm. Il y a probablement une sortie de journalisation supplémentaire ci-dessus.

npm ERR ! Un journal complet de cette exécution peut être trouvé dans :

npm ERR ! C:Utilisateurs*
**AppDataRoamingnpm-cache_logs2017-07-06T01_07_47_983Z-debug.log

求大佬指点,给大佬递茶。公司内网,代理已经配置好,不过我的权限可能有的网站和端口会github能上,node.js官网能上,源用的是cnpm。

ringa_leeringa_lee2661 Il y a quelques jours2126

répondre à tous(4)je répondrai

  • 淡淡烟草味

    淡淡烟草味2017-07-06 10:37:57

    Créez un fichier nommé .npmrc dans le même répertoire que package.json, puis installez python, de préférence la version 2.X

    Mettez-y la phrase suivante

    sass_binary_site=https://npm.taobao.org/mirrors/node-sass/

    répondre
    0
  • 三叔

    三叔2017-07-06 10:37:57

    L'invite indique que vous devez installer Python. Vous pouvez essayer d'installer Python, puis définir la variable d'environnement PYTHON et la réinstaller.

    répondre
    0
  • 扔个三星炸死你

    扔个三星炸死你2017-07-06 10:37:57

    Créez .npmrc dans le répertoire racine

    phantomjs_cdnurl=http://cnpmjs.org/downloads
    sass_binary_site=https://npm.taobao.org/mirrors/node-sass/
    registry=https://registry.npm.taobao.org

    Après avoir enregistré, réinstallez npm

    répondre
    0
  • PHP中文网

    PHP中文网2017-07-06 10:37:57

    J'ai également essayé d'installer nodesass hier et cela a échoué. Plus tard, je suis passé au miroir Taobao et je l'ai installé avec succès
    $ npm install -g cnpm --registry=https://registry.npm.taobao.org (installer le miroir Taobao)

    $ cnpm install node-sass --save (utilisez l'image Taobao pour installer node-sass)

    répondre
    0
  • Annulerrépondre